About Zip Code 62454

Zip code 62454 is located in Illinois and is home to approximately 10,604 residents. It receives an overall grade of B+ (score: 76/100), based on safety, affordability, quality of life, and employment metrics.

Crime rates here are below the national average, suggesting a relatively safe community.

With a median household income of $64,668 and home values around $119,100, this zip code offers strong affordability. Residents typically spend a manageable share of their income on housing.

Educational attainment is below the national average, with 21.8% of adults holding a bachelor's degree or higher.

Unemployment stands at 3.5%, which is near the national average.

Scores are percentile-based: a score of 85 means this zip code ranks better than 85% of all US zip codes on that dimension. Data is sourced from the US Census Bureau (ACS 5-year estimates) and the FBI Uniform Crime Report.

Methodology

All scores are percentile-based (0–100): a score of 85 means this zip code ranks better than 85% of all US zip codes on that metric. Safety uses FBI Uniform Crime Report state-level data (Phase 2 will add zip-level granularity). Economic and demographic data is from the US Census Bureau American Community Survey (ACS) 5-year estimates (2022).
